Embodiment 1

[0017] Add 200g of humic acid and 240g of propylene oxide into the container, stir and mix evenly, heat up to 120°C in a closed container, react for 6h, and dry. Add 200 parts of the above-mentioned modified humic acid in the container, take 100 g of octadecylamine and add it to the humic acid, mix the solid grains of the two reactants, stir evenly, put the prepared mixture into the reaction container, and put it in a non-airtight Under certain conditions, after driving oxygen with nitrogen for 30 minutes, seal the reaction vessel, heat the closed reaction vessel to 200°C, and start the reaction between the modified humic acid and the organic amine in the vessel, and react at this temperature for 8 hours. After the reaction product is cooled to room temperature, it is pulverized by a pulverizer and passed through a 60-mesh sieve to obtain the oil-based drilling fluid fluid loss control agent product.

Embodiment 2

[0019] Add 200g of humic acid and 200g of propylene oxide into the container, stir and mix evenly, heat up to 120°C in a closed container, react for 4 hours, and dry. Add 200g of the above-mentioned modified humic acid into the container, take 80g of octadecyltrimethylammonium chloride and add it to the humic acid, mix the solid grains of the two reactants, stir evenly, and put the prepared mixture into the reaction container In the process, under non-airtight conditions, use nitrogen to drive oxygen for 30 minutes, then seal the reaction vessel, and heat the closed reaction vessel to 180°C, so that the modified humic acid and organic amine in the vessel start to react. The reaction was carried out for 10 hours. After the reaction product is cooled to room temperature, it is pulverized by a pulverizer and passed through a 60-mesh sieve to obtain the oil-based drilling fluid fluid loss control agent product.

Embodiment 3

[0021] Add 200g of humic acid and 180g of propylene oxide into the container, stir and mix evenly, heat up to 80°C in a closed container, react for 8 hours, and dry. Add 200 parts of the above-mentioned modified humic acid in the container, take 60g of dodecylamine and add it to the humic acid, mix the solid grains of the two reactants, stir evenly, put the prepared mixture into the reaction container, and put it in a non-closed Under certain conditions, after 30 minutes of oxygen driving with nitrogen, the reaction vessel is sealed, and the closed reaction vessel is heated to 220° C., so that the modified humic acid and organic amine in the vessel start to react, and the reaction is carried out at this temperature for 8 hours. After the reaction product is cooled to room temperature, it is pulverized by a pulverizer and passed through a 60-mesh sieve to obtain the oil-based drilling fluid fluid loss control agent product.

Abstract

The invention discloses a humic-acid oil-soluble filtrate reducer which comprises the following components in parts by weight: 100-200 parts of modified humic acid and 40-80 parts of organic amine, preferably 150-200 parts of modified humic acid and 60-80 parts of organic amine. The modified humic acid comprises the following components in parts by weight: 100-200 parts of humic acid and 150-240 parts of a cross-linking agent, preferably 150-200 parts of humic acid and 180-220 parts of the cross-linking agent. The filtrate reducer provided by the invention comprises the simple components, has a favorable filtrate reduction effect, is resistant to high temperature, environment-friendly and free of fluorescence, and can be applied to development and research of exploratory wells.

Description

technical field [0001] The invention relates to an oil-soluble fluid loss reducer, in particular to a humic acid oil-soluble fluid loss reducer for drilling fluid and a preparation method thereof. Background technique [0002] Oil-based drilling fluid has the advantages of excellent lubricating performance, strong inhibition, good wellbore stability and good temperature resistance, and has been widely used. The fluid loss control agents used in oil-based drilling fluids are mainly asphalt products. Although asphalt fluid loss control agents have good fluid loss control effects, they will affect the ROP and cause pollution to the environment. , When asphalt products are used as fluid loss control agents for oil-based drilling fluids, their performance is limited to a certain extent.
